What is an Online Slot?

Online Slot

An Online Slot is a game where you play with coins on a series of vertical reels filled with symbols. The game makes use of a random number generator, which is checked regularly to ensure fair play. The objective of Online Slot is to get a combination of matching symbols on a payline. Most Online Slots have horizontal paylines, while some have vertical and diagonal paylines. You will first need to choose a coin size and payline configuration. Some Online Slots will let you bet on all possible combinations, while others will have fixed paylines. Free spins are often included, as are other features, such as prize multipliers.
